Diagnosis & Repair Procedure
- Inspect circuits between ECM and oxygen sensor for opens or shorts. See wiring diagram in the WIRING DIAGRAMS - 3.4L article. Repair as needed. If all circuits are okay, connect scan tool. See Figure.
- Start engine and warm to normal operating temperature. Monitor heated oxygen sensor output voltage and short-term fuel trim. If scan tool indicates a lean condition (.55 volt or less, +20 trim) or rich condition (.4 volt or more, -20 trim), see CODE P0170 - FUEL TRIM MALFUNCTION.
- If scan tool indicates other than as specified in step 2), operate engine at 2500 RPM for 90 seconds. Monitor oxygen sensor voltage. If voltage constantly fluctuates in wide range (.3-.9 volt), repeat TEST DRIVE CONFIRMATION. If voltage does NOT fluctuate, or stays in narrow range, replace sensor and retest.
